Strong association of common variants in the CDKN2A/CDKN2B region with type 2 diabetes in French Europids
AssociationN=3,093Duesing K. et al.(2008)· Diabetologia

A replication study of genome-wide association findings in the CDKN2A/CDKN2B region on chromosome 9p in 3,093 French Europids (1,455 cases, 1,638 controls). The study confirms a strong association of rs10811661 with type 2 diabetes (p=3.8×10⁻⁷, OR 1.43 [95% CI 1.24-1.64]) and identifies rs3218018 as a secondary signal surviving Bonferroni correction (p=0.002). The rs564398 variant did not reach significance in this population.
